#b6b3ce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#b6b3ce is composed of 71.4% red, 70.2% green and 80.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 11.7% cyan, 13.1% magenta, 0% yellow and 19.2% black. It has a hue angle of 246.7 degrees, a saturation of 21.6% and a lightness of 75.5%. #b6b3ce color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#6d679d. Closest websafe color is: #cccccc.

Shades and Tints of #b6b3ce

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050507 is the darkest color, while #fbfbfc is the lightest one.

Tones of #b6b3ce

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#bdbdc4 is the less saturated color, while #9183fe is the most saturated one.
